Controls, Indicators, and Symbols
DESCRIPTION OF CONTROLS
Function Buttons
The Power On/Off button. Used to turn the NPB-290
monitor on or off.
The Alarm Silence button. Used to silence current
alarms for the alarm silence duration period. It is also
used to view and adjust alarm silence duration and the
alarm volume.
The Adjust Up button. Used to increase alarm limit
values, alarm silence duration, as well as alarm and pulse
beep volumes. Also used to scroll through menu items.
The Adjust Down button. Used to decrease alarm limit
values, alarm silence duration, as well as alarm and pulse
beep volumes. Also used to scroll through menu items.
The Upper Alarm Limit button. Used to view upper
alarm limits. When this button is pressed at the same
time as the Lower Alarm Limit button, menu options are
accessible. It is also used to select menu options.
The Lower Alarm Limit button. Used to view lower
alarm limits. When this button is pressed at the same
time as the Upper Alarm Limit button, menu options are
accessible. It is also used to exit menus without change.
Indicators
The AC Power indicator. Lights continuously when the
NPB-290 is connected to AC power. This light is off
when the monitor is being powered by its internal
battery. When lit, it also indicates that the battery is
charging.
The Low Battery indicator. When 15 minutes or less
battery capacity remains, the indicator lights continuously
and a low priority alarm sounds.
The Alarm Silence indicator. Lights continuously when
an active audible alarm has been silenced. It flashes
when alarms are permanently silenced.
The Motion indicator. Lights continuously when the
monitor detects motion sufficient enough to affect
readings.
